Join our collaborative Legal Affairs Department and work alongside a team of experienced lawyers, paralegals, and legal assistants supporting litigation matters related to Group disability benefits, Group and individual life insurance, Critical illness insurance, Accidental death and dismemberment (AD&D) claims. As a Legal Assistant at Desjardins Financial Security (DFS), you will play an integral role in supporting the litigation team throughout the lifecycle of legal files. You will be responsible for coordinating administrative and legal processes, maintaining litigation records, preparing legal documentation, and ensuring deadlines are met in accordance with court procedures and internal standards. This position is ideal for a highly organized and detail-oriented professional who thrives in a fast-paced legal environment. You will have the opportunity to work on complex insurance and disability-related litigation matters while collaborating closely with legal professionals and external stakeholders. Success in this role requires strong organizational skills, sound judgment, professionalism, discretion with confidential information, and the ability to effectively manage competing priorities while delivering exceptional support to the legal team. More specifically, you will be required to: 

  • Provide comprehensive administrative, clerical, and legal support to lawyers handling litigation matters, ensuring efficient file management and workflow coordination

  • Manage and maintain physical and electronic litigation files, including document organization, records management, and file tracking throughout all stages of litigation

  • Prepare, format, proofread, and assemble legal documents such as affidavits of documents, motion records, document briefs, pleadings, correspondence, and court filings

  • Monitor litigation timelines, court deadlines, limitation periods, and key file milestones to ensure compliance with procedural requirements and proactive follow-up

  • Draft routine legal correspondence, reports, templates, and other legal and administrative documentation while maintaining accuracy and professionalism

  • Coordinate meetings, discoveries, mediations, examinations, client appointments, and other litigation-related activities, including calendar management and scheduling

  • Arrange document services, court filings, and communications with external counsel, courts, insurers, experts, and other stakeholders while ensuring compliance with applicable procedures

  • Provide ongoing legal and administrative support to the litigation team by managing document production, transcription, scanning, filing, data entry, and process improvement initiatives while contributing to a collaborative team environment

What you need to know about the Toronto Tech Scene

Although home to some of the biggest names in tech, including Google, Microsoft and Amazon, Toronto has established itself as one of the largest startup ecosystems in the world. And with over 2,000 startups — more than 30 percent of the country's total startups — Toronto continues to attract new businesses. Be it helping entrepreneurs manage their finances, simplifying business operations by automating payroll or assisting pharmaceutical companies in launching new drugs, the city's tech scene is just getting started.
